Tedeschi Nets OT Winner to Boost Bentley by Philadelphia
PHILADELPHIA – Freshman Leigh Tedeschi (Duxbury, Mass./Duxbury HS) scored the game-winning goal with 32 seconds left in overtime to cap a furious comeback and lift Bentley to a 15-14 win over Philadelphia University on Friday afternoon in non-conference Division II women's lacrosse action at Ravenhill Field. The Falcons evened their record at 1-1 after reversing their score from Wednesday's season opener, while the Rams dropped to 1-1.
Bentley trailed 13-4 in the contest, but scored 10 unanswered goals to take a one-goal lead going into the final minute of play. The Rams got an equalizer in the waning seconds to send the game to overtime and the score remained knotted at 14-14 until the final minute of the extra frame, when Tedeschi netted her third of the year to send the Falcons off with the victory.
Junior All-America Alyssa Ritchie (North Andover, Mass./North Andover HS) powered the Falcons' offense with six goals and an assist, while senior Beth Gendron (Tyngsboro, Mass./Tyngsboro HS) netted three goals for the second straight game. Sophomore Jaclyn Griffin (Barrington, Ill./Barrington HS) chipped in a pair of goals and four assists.
The Falcons are in action again on Wednesday when they travel to North Andover, Mass., to face Northeast-10 Conference foe Merrimack at 4:00 p.m. before the home opener on Saturday, March 22, against tenth-ranked Southern New Hampshire at 4:00 p.m.
